Material innovation — what to choose for recyclable, protective olive oil bottles
Olive oil is sensitive to light and oxygen. Any sustainable packaging must balance barrier performance with recyclability. Here are the best 2026 material choices and how they stack up.
1. Recycled dark glass (rGlass) — the safe, recyclable classic
Benefits: Excellent UV protection, widely recyclable and perceived as premium. In 2026, more furnaces accept high‑rGlass mixes, lowering embodied carbon. Use thin‑wall, dark amber or deep green glass and laser‑etch brand and batch info to avoid extra labels.
Drawbacks: Heavier than alternatives (higher transport emissions) and can shatter — but lightweighting advances in late 2025 reduced glass thickness without losing strength.
2. Aluminium bottles and cans — lightweight and infinitely recyclable
Benefits: Superb barrier to light and oxygen, very light, and aluminium is routinely recycled in closed loops. Aluminium bottles give a sleek, tech‑minimalist aesthetic and are ideal for refill systems.
Drawbacks: Must ensure internal food‑grade lining is recyclable or PFC‑free; choose mono‑coatings introduced in 2025 which improve recyclability.
3. High‑barrier mono‑polymer plastics (rPET and advanced mono‑PE) — practical and circular
Benefits: Lightweight and suitable for lightweight pump dispensers and pouches. rPET with additional barrier coatings (mono‑material solutions rolled out in early 2026) allows recycling in existing streams.
Drawbacks: Must ensure barrier is mono and compatible with recycling; avoid multi‑layer laminates unless fully separable.
4. Paperboard + inner barrier (paper‑based bottles) — bold minimalist option
Paper beverage containers advanced in 2025 with recyclable inner barriers. For olive oil, choose validated food‑grade barrier developments (PHAs or recyclable PE linings) and pair with a small, re‑sealable dispenser to limit headspace and oxidation.
5. Compostable bio‑polymers (PHA) and next‑gen bioplastics — emerging but watchful
Benefits: Lower carbon and home/industrial compostable options. In 2026 a few premium producers use PHA liners for limited edition oils.
Drawbacks: Commercial composting availability remains limited in parts of the UK; check local waste infrastructure before choosing compostable as the primary end‑of‑life strategy.
Design features that reduce waste and boost trust
Apply these tech‑inspired minimalist design choices to your olive oil bottle or packaging.
Laser‑etched, minimal graphics
Replace full‑colour printed labels with laser etching or embossing on glass and aluminium. This removes glued paper labels and adhesives that hinder recycling while delivering a premium tactile feel.
Integrated NFC + QR provenance chips
Small NFC tags or printed QR codes let buyers access detailed provenance without cluttering the front of the bottle. Link to harvest date, GPS of grove, mill press time, lab analysis and carbon footprint. In 2026 consumer acceptance of NFC for product authentication has risen significantly following retail pilots in late 2025.
Minimal tamper‑evident closures
Choose tamper seals that are mono‑material (thin aluminium rings, simple biodegradable films) rather than multi‑part plastics. Magnetic or screw closures in aluminium or rGlass provide a premium feel and are easy to recycle separately.
Small neck, measured pourers and limit‑waste spouts
Design the neck and spout to control flow (reducing over‑pouring), and offer a reusable pourer that stores with the bottle. Fewer accidents mean less wasted oil and fewer secondary disposables like paper towels.
Refill‑ready geometry
Design bottles to sit securely in refill kiosks and to be collapsible when empty (for pouches). Tech minimalism emphasises form that directly responds to function — keep form factors consistent across SKUs so refilling is easier on the infrastructure side.
Provenance labeling that actually builds trust
Minimalist design doesn’t mean removing information — it means presenting it clearly. Use a layered approach:
- Front face: Brand, cultivar(s), year/harvest.
- Subtle icon row: Key certifications (Organic, PDO, COI), small carbon icon, refill symbol.
- Digital layer: QR/NFC that opens a single, mobile‑optimised page with full traceability: GPS of grove, mill/press date, lab results (free acidity, peroxide value), sensory notes, producer story and sustainability metrics.
This approach keeps the bottle elegant while giving buyers the full transparency they demand. In early 2026, standardised digital provenance pages are emerging as a best practice across artisan food categories.

Refill and circular business models — practical strategies
Minimalist tech packaging pairs naturally with refill ecosystems. Here are workable models for producers and merchants in 2026.
1. Refill kiosks in retail and restaurants
Install kiosks that dispense measured amounts into customer bottles. Use aluminium or glass returnable bottles with NFC to track returns and sterilisation cycles. Pilot programs in European cities were scaled in late 2025 and have shown strong reuse rates when paired with incentives.
2. Home refill pouches and concentrate cartridges
Offer lightweight refill pouches with a recyclable mono‑film and a small pour spout for home transfer. This dramatically reduces transport emissions and material per litre.
3. Deposit‑return or subscription return schemes
Charge a small deposit for premium aluminium or glass bottles that’s refunded on return. Alternatively, offer a subscription where you collect, sanitise and reuse bottles. These models align with consumer willingness to pay for sustainability in 2026.
Checklist: How a small producer can switch to minimalist, recyclable packaging
- Audit current packaging footprint (materials, weight, end‑of‑life).
- Choose a primary container (rGlass or aluminium preferred for quality protection).
- Select mono‑material closures and avoid glued labels; opt for laser‑etching or single‑material labels where possible.
- Integrate a digital provenance layer (QR + optional NFC) linking to lab results and a producer story.
- Design for refill: consistent bottle geometry and a small neck for measured pours.
- Partner with local recyclers or takeback schemes; pilot a deposit or refill program.
- Run shelf‑life stability testing for the chosen material (6–12 month accelerated tests recommended).
For buyers: how to spot genuinely sustainable, minimalist olive oil packaging
- Look for mono‑materials or laser‑etched glass instead of heavy paper labels and plastic caps glued on.
- Check for clear provenance via QR/NFC that shows harvest date, mill and lab analysis.
- Prefer aluminium bottles or dark rGlass for long‑term storage; avoid clear glass for long‑shelf oils.
- Ask about refill options or deposit schemes — brands committed to circularity will advertise this plainly.

Regulatory and infrastructure context — what brands must watch in 2026
Policy in the UK and EU tightened in late 2025, accelerating recycled content mandates and producer responsibility requirements. This increases the value of lightweight, recyclable packaging and takeback schemes. Brands should:
- Monitor national EPR (Extended Producer Responsibility) obligations and prepare accurate packaging waste data.
- Prioritise materials that meet new recycled content targets and are accepted by local recyclers.
- Document and publish end‑of‑life pathways on digital provenance pages to show compliance and build consumer trust.
